The Senior Systems Engineer leads the design, integration, testing, deployment, training, and sustainment of packet-based hardware and software systems utilizing Commercial Off-The-Shelf (COTS) and Government Off-The-Shelf (GOTS) products. This role drives end-to-end systems integration across hardware, software, and network components to ensure seamless interoperability, operational performance, and mission success.
 
Due to federal contract requirements, United States Citizenship and position appropriate security clearance is required. (e.g. Active TS/SCI security clearance with agency appropriate polygraph).
  • Lead the design, integration, testing, deployment, training, and maintenance of packet-based hardware and software systems leveraging COTS and GOTS products.
  • Direct end-to-end systems integration across hardware, software, and network components, ensuring interoperability, scalability, and performance optimization.
  • Develop and execute system integration plans, validation and verification procedures, and deployment strategies to ensure operational readiness and requirements compliance.
  • Develop, update, and maintain BASH and PERL scripts to automate initial system setup, configuration, and ongoing maintenance of core servers and clustered computing environments.
  • Implement automation and process improvements to enhance system reliability, efficiency, and maintainability.
  • Provide technical leadership, troubleshooting, and lifecycle sustainment support, including upgrades, patching, and performance tuning.
  • Deliver training and technical guidance to administrators, operators, and cross-functional engineering teams while ensuring adherence to security and configuration management standards.

  • TS/SCI with agency appropriate poly
  • Minimum of twenty (20) years of Systems Engineering experience on programs/contracts of similar scope, type, and complexity.
  • Bachelor's degree in technical discipline related to Information Technology, Systems Engineering, Computer Science, or a related field. Five (5) additional years of Systems Engineering experience may be substituted in lieu of a degree
